Analysis
In 2024, out-of-school rate for adolescents and youth of lower and upper in Kiribati stood at 6.0%.
The figure is up 17.2% on the previous year and down 73.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, out-of-school rate for adolescents and youth of lower and upper in Kiribati peaked at 36.2% in 2017 and was at its lowest, 5.1%, in 2023.
Kiribati ranks 118th of 175 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
Out-of-school rate for adolescents and youth of lower and upper in Kiribati,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2015 | 22.6% | — |
| 2016 | 22.0% | -2.6% |
| 2017 | 36.2% | +64.9% |
| 2021 | 11.0% | -69.5% |
| 2022 | 8.4% | -23.5% |
| 2023 | 5.1% | -39.2% |
| 2024 | 6.0% | +17.2% |
Kiribati compared with similar countries
- Kiribati's 6.0% is below the median for lower middle income countries, which is 26.6%, 23% of the median. (38 countries reporting)
- Kiribati's 6.0% is below the median for East Asia & Pacific, which is 13.5%, 45% of the median. (28 countries reporting)
